Menene kewaye amplifier?
Kafin mu zurfafa cikin halayensu, bari mu fara ayyana abin da muke nufi da da'ira mai ƙara ƙarfi.A taƙaice, da'irar amplifier da'irar wutar lantarki ce da'irar lantarki wacce ke haɓaka siginonin lantarki zuwa matakin wuta mafi girma wanda ya dace da tuƙi, kamar lasifika ko eriya.Yawanci, da'irar ƙararrawar wutar lantarki suna ɗaukar siginar shigarwar ƙaramar sauti ko mitar rediyo kuma suna haɓaka shi sosai don samar da mahimman ƙarfin aikace-aikacen da aka yi niyya.

Halayen kewayawa na ƙara ƙarfi
1. Ƙarfin sarrafa wutar lantarki: Ƙirar wutar lantarki an tsara su don ɗaukar matakan wutar lantarki mafi girma idan aka kwatanta da sauran nau'in amplifiers.Ƙarfinsu na isar da iko mai mahimmanci yana ba su damar fitar da kaya masu buƙata cikin inganci da dogaro.

2. Linearity: Power amplifiers suna ƙoƙari don kiyaye siffar daidai da cikakkun bayanai na siginar shigarwa.Linearity yana da mahimmanci don rage ɓarna da tabbatar da haifuwar siginar ta asali.

3. Ƙwarewa: Ƙwarewa shine mahimmancin la'akari a cikin da'irar amplifier na wutar lantarki saboda yana ƙayyade canjin wutar lantarki zuwa ikon fitarwa mai amfani.Ƙarfin wutar lantarki mai ƙarfi yana rage yawan sharar wutar lantarki, ta haka yana rage yawan baturi da zubar da zafi.

4. Bandwidth: bandwidth na da'irar amplifier na wutar lantarki yana nufin iyakar mita wanda zai iya haɓaka da aminci.Dangane da aikace-aikacen, za a iya ƙirƙira masu haɓaka wutar lantarki azaman masu ƙara ƙarfin sauti da ke aiki a cikin kewayon sauti, ko na'urorin ƙara ƙarfin mitar rediyo da ake amfani da su a cikin tsarin sadarwa mara waya.

Babban ayyuka na kewaye amplifier wutar lantarki
1. Ƙwaƙwalwar sigina: Babban aikin da'irar amplifier ɗin wutar lantarki shine haɓaka siginar zuwa matakin ƙarfin wuta mafi girma ta yadda za ta iya shawo kan rashin ƙarfi na kaya, kamar lasifika ko eriya.Ƙarfin wutar lantarki yana kula da aminci da ingancin siginar shigarwa yayin samar da isasshen iko don fitar da kaya.

2. Matching da impedance: Matsakaicin amplifier na wutar lantarki yawanci ana sanye su da hanyar sadarwa mai dacewa da impedance don inganta canjin wutar lantarki tsakanin amplifier da kaya.Wannan yana tabbatar da iyakar ƙarfin watsawa, rage girman tunani da asarar sigina.

3. Sharadi na sigina: Ƙarfin wutar lantarki na iya ƙunsar matakan daidaita sigina don haɓaka ingancin siginar shigarwa, cire hayaniya, ko amfani da takamaiman tacewa don daidaita fitarwa don takamaiman aikace-aikacen.Waɗannan matakan na iya haɗawa da na'urori masu mahimmanci, masu daidaitawa, ko masu tacewa.

4. Tsare-tsare na karewa: Na'urorin ƙara ƙarfin wutar lantarki galibi suna da ginanniyar tsarin kariya don hana yuwuwar lalacewa ta hanyar matsanancin ƙarfin lantarki, halin yanzu, ko zafi.Waɗannan hanyoyin kariya suna taimakawa tsawaita rayuwar amplifier yayin tabbatar da aiki mai aminci.
